“Today, we give new impetus to the development of Poland-Azerbaijan relations. During the presidency of Kaczyński, he made visits to Azerbaijan and I made visits to Poland. During these visits, we strengthened our friendship, talked about joint projects, and initiated some projects. Now, the next period of Polish-Azerbaijani relations is beginning,” he said.
The Azerbaijani president said that a sincere exchange of ideas took place during the meeting.
“Poland and Azerbaijan are two friendly countries. We will continue to strengthen our friendship and we will make joint efforts for the development of our relations.
Today, many important documents were signed. These documents determine the prospects of our cooperation. Of course, I would like to note the Joint Declaration on Strategic Partnership and Economic Cooperation signed by the Presidents. This is a very serious political document. This declaration covers almost all aspects of our relations, as well as political, economic, energy, transport issues. This declaration also mentions the Armenian-Azerbaijani Nagorno-Karabakh conflict and notes that this conflict should be resolved based on the principles of sovereignty, territorial integrity of states, inviolability of their borders and resolutions of the UN Security Council. I would like to express my gratitude to you, Mr. President, for this fair position. I want to add that the Azerbaijani state and people have been suffering from Armenian occupation for more than twenty years now. As a result of this occupation, 20 percent of our lands have been occupied. More than one million Azerbaijanis have become refugees and displaced persons in their native lands. This conflict should only be resolved on the basis of the norms and principles of international law, within the territorial integrity of the countries. These theses are reflected in the Joint Declaration,” he said.
The Azerbaijani president said that the mutual relations cover the economic sphere.
“Transport and energy - I think these should be priority directions of the economic bloc. In the field of energy, Azerbaijani oil is delivered to Polish markets. Today, along with partner countries, Azerbaijan is successfully implementing the Southern Gas Corridor project. This project will deliver Azerbaijani gas to Europe. The total cost of the project is $40 billion and its implementation is being successfully carried out. I hope that the first phase of this project will be completed by next year and the second—and final—phase by 2020. Thus, Azerbaijan will act as a very reliable partner for Europe,” said Ilham Aliyev.
